Cavs’ Evan Mobley Will Earn Extra $45 Million If He Wins DPOY Or Makes All-NBA Team

The Cleveland Cavaliers signed Evan Mobley to a five-year, $224 million extension in 2024. The deal includes designated rookie language, so the contract could be worth 27.5% or 30% of the cap.

If Mobley wins the Defensive Player of the Year Award or makes one of the three All-NBA teams this year, he will earn an extra $45 million. 

“Definitely, it was a goal of mine coming into this year, and I mean, I put all the work in, so it’s a big day,” Mobley said, via The Athletic. “But I’m trying to be as focused as possible on the playoffs and just trying to go as far as we can.”

Mobley averaged 18.5 points, 9.3 rebounds, 3.2 assists, 0.9 steals and 1.6 blocks during the regular season. 

“His rebounds (9.3), blocks (1.6) and steals (0.9) were all around his career averages, but don’t be distracted by stagnant numbers in those categories,” The Athletic’s Joe Vardon wrote. “Mobley ranked fourth in the NBA in blocks among players who played at least 65 games, and he was the only player to average at least 1.5 blocks and fewer than two fouls per game. He is just the eighth player in NBA history to average that many blocks on two or fewer fouls per game while also contributing at least 0.8 steals per game.

“Mobley was fifth in the NBA in contested shots (10.4 per game) and seventh in contested 3s (3.2 per game) for a Cavs defense that was the eighth-best overall and third in opponent field goal percentage (.454). They were a much better defensive team when Mobley was on the court (seventh in the league at 111.7 points per 100 possessions allowed) versus when he was on the bench (17th, 114.3 points per 100 possessions allowed).”

The Cavs are up 2-0 against the Miami Heat in the first round of the 2025 playoffs.

Mobley had nine points and seven rebounds in Game 1 and 20 points and six rebounds in Game 2.
